Keyboard layout ABNT and ABNT2
I've got an U.K. keyboard in a Dell - Inspiron 1501 and I want to configure it to Portuguese - ABNT, but when I do it, the keyboard works like ABNT2 (another Brazilian keyboard). And when I select ABNT2, it works like ABNT2.
So, how could I configure my keyboard to ABNT?
Is there any place where I can re-install the drivers or is it a known issue?

Thank you for your help, but I tried it already and was the same.
What I found out with a friend is setting my language to Portuguese (BR) and the keyboard layout to United States International. Then, I will have these special character "ç, á, ü, etc".
There are small differences between US and UK keyboards, but it's not a big difference like US to Hungarian.... :-)
